EN 1.4318 Stainless Steel vs. EN 1.4429 Stainless Steel

Both EN 1.4318 stainless steel and EN 1.4429 stainless steel are iron alloys. Both are furnished in the solution annealed (AT) condition. They have a moderately high 92% of their average alloy composition in common.

For each property being compared, the top bar is EN 1.4318 stainless steel and the bottom bar is EN 1.4429 stainless steel.
